Merrily We Roll Along
Stephen Sondheim is generally acknowledged as the greatest musical theatre composer alive today. He is known for having taken the musical artform into darker, less cheery terrain with discordant melodies and mature subject matter, often holding up the mirror to life's unpleasantries. From the failed connections of the romantic relationships in Company to the bloody horrors of Sweeney Todd, Sondheim's works are among the most challenging and musically complex works in the musical theatre canon. The high schools that do tackle Sondheim usually pick the more accessible dark/light fairy-tale laden Into the Woods.  Few, however, take on the cautionary musical tale of Merrily We Roll Along.

A legendary bomb when it opened in 1981, the musical closed in a month after largely negative reviews, although the music remained a fan favorite for years.  Several retoolings and revised productions later, the musical has been reworked and redeemed, winning Britain's version of the Tony Awards in 2012 for Best Musical.  The play has an unusual dramatic structure in that it goes backwards in time.  The story begins in 1976 and follows Franklin Shepard, a successful Hollywood producer who appears to have it all - fame, fortune and all the trappings of success.  But as the play unfolds, we go back in time to see he was once an up-and-coming musical theater composer, who sold out this talent, family, friends and ideals in the quest for commercial success. It is the haunting, heart-breaking tale of potential wasted, and recommended for mature audiences.
